The Central Records Clerk is responsible and accountable to the Central Records Supervisor for the efficient and timely performance of the assigned duties and responsibilities. Specific responsibilities shall include but not be limited to:

Transcribes, enters, formats and/or links on the Records Management System (RMS) reports and data received by dictation system, hard copy (e.g. police reports, etc.) or other format.

  • Review and evaluate received reports and documents to update and maintain Niche (RMS) data.
  • Prepare and assemble relative documents for all charge files (Bail Court, Futures and Warrant Requests) and create police issued release orders.
  • Liaise with Officers, Watch Commanders, Special Constables and Court Services to verify the accuracy of file documentation ensuring the integrity of Niche RMS data.
  • Classify minor incidents adhering to Statistics Canada and internal policies.
  • Process requests for motor vehicle accident statements and insurance reports pursuant to Law Enforcement and Records (Managers) Network (LEARN) guidelines and legislation.
  • Conduct C.P.I.C. queries and send C.P.I.C. messages to obtain and update information for custody files.
  • Responds to internal and external telephone and counter inquiries and provides information by accessing various records (e.g. insurance companies, law firms, other police services, etc.).
  • Types correspondence, prepares special projects, insurance queries, etc. and other tasks for the Records Manager.
  • Maintains, processes, and files records, forms, and lists (e.g. MVC, CD files, non-computerized reports, court requests, criminal records etc.).
  • Applies retention bylaw including reviewing, indexing, transferring and destroying files.
  • All other duties as assigned within the core competencies.
